The 2012 Parlemeter shows that there has been a net increase in public interest in European affairs since 2006. Main results are: Europeans’ image of the European Parliament has remained more or less stable over the past year; an absolute majority of Europeans consider that "tackling poverty" is the policy that should be upheld as a matter of priority by the European Parliament. "Coordinating economic policies" comes in second place, cited by more than a third of respondents, followed by "improving consumer and public health protection", cited by a third; the "protection of human rights" remains the most important value in the eyes of Europeans.
